What are the four skills of English?

The four skills of English refer to listening, reading, speaking, and writing, which will be explained in detail below.

Listening skills

Listening comprehension is the ability to hear English and understand its meaning correctly. Both the ability to understand that the sound coming from the ear is English and the ability to connect the heard English with Japanese and understand the meaning are required. By catching the conversation, we absorb knowledge and communicate with the other person to deepen our understanding. If your listening skills are weak, you will not be able to communicate in English. Listening is the key to that conversation, and it is said to be an important foundation for English proficiency.

Reading skills

Reading ability is the ability to understand English sentences quickly and accurately. If you can understand the content written in English directly as English without going through Japanese, you can read English sentences smoothly. When you have reading ability, you will be able to understand the English words more reliably with not only the voice information coming from your ears but also the textual information coming from your eyes. At the same time, you can effectively improve your speaking and writing skills, and the synergistic effect will dramatically improve your English.

Speaking skills

Speaking ability refers to two skills: communicating with each other using English and communicating one's opinion to the other. Speaking regards these two skills as two areas, and sometimes calls the four skills of English "4 skills and 5 areas". Specifically, in addition to the communication ability of having a conversation with others, the speaking ability must be equipped to give a presentation in front of the public and to convey one's opinion to the listener in an easy-to-understand and logical manner in discussions. Writing skills

Writing ability is the ability to write English sentences correctly and smoothly. It includes the ability to understand grammar and words, and to understand paragraph structures. It is evaluated that you have writing ability if you can develop the story with logically orderly content according to the correct grammar so that the other party can understand it. In addition, it is also required to have the ability to develop logical sentences by stating a conclusion and then giving a reason.

How to measure 4 English skills?

The four skills of English can be measured by taking a certification test. Here, we will introduce a test that can measure 4 skills and explain how you can measure skills.

TOEIC

TOEIC is a test to measure practical English communication skills in business situations and daily life. TOEIC is a well-known and popular test that is often used as an index to measure the evaluation of English in employment. "TOEIC L & R", which measures reading and writing skills, is known as the general TOEIC. It is not a pass/fail form, but a maximum of 990 points, 495 points for listening and 495 points for reading, and is evaluated by a score in increments of 5 points. There is also a "TOEIC S & W" test that measures speaking and writing skills, and it is possible to measure 4 skills by taking this test as well.

Practical English Proficiency Test

The official name is "Practical English Proficiency Test", which is a large-scale English qualification test in Japan sponsored by the Eiken Foundation of Japan and sponsored by the Ministry of Education, Culture, Sports, Science and Technology. You can measure your English proficiency in a wide range of fields, from daily life to business situations.

There are 7 grades, 1st grade, quasi 1st grade, 2nd grade, quasi 2nd grade, 3rd grade, 4th grade, and 5th grade. Measure only 2 skills. However, those who wish to have Level 4 or Level 5 can also take a speaking test that does not affect pass/fail. In the transcript sent after the exam, you can see not only the pass / fail judgment but also the Eiken CSE score corresponding to CEFR, which is an international evaluation standard for foreign language proficiency, so you can know your objective English proficiency.

TOEFL ibt

This is a four-skill measurement test that is taken mainly by non-native English speakers to enter an English-speaking university or graduate school, or by those who want to study abroad to prove their English proficiency. There is no pass or fail like Eiken, and it is displayed as a score in 1-point increments within 0 to 120 points. The test will be conducted at the facility where the PC is installed. Since it is used as a test to measure the English proficiency required for university entrance, there are many problems with the content in daily life and school life. Of the four skills, listening conversation is said to be difficult for Japanese to hear because it is quite conversational in American English.

IELTS

IELTS has two types of tests, academic module and general module, depending on the purpose. The Academic Module is a test to measure whether non-native English speakers can enter an English-speaking university or graduate school and understand the lessons. The General Module measures language proficiency in English-speaking employment and vocational training, and scores are used as proof of English proficiency when applying for migration to Australia, Canada, New Zealand, etc. There are two types of answering methods, written and computerized, both of which measure four skills.

GTEC

The official name of GTEC is "Global Test of English Communication", which is an English 4 skill test conducted by Benesse Corporation. You can score each skill and measure your English proficiency by absolute evaluation. There are many questions that assume situations where you actually use English, and the writing and speaking tests are graded with an emphasis on whether or not they are properly communicated to the other party. TEAP

TEAP is an abbreviation of "Test of English for Academic Purposes" and is an English test for high school students that can measure 4 skills. A test jointly developed by the Eiken Foundation of Japan and Sophia University to improve English proficiency in academic situations such as searching for materials and literature in English and expressing opinions in English during study and research at the university. Cambridge English Test

An English test developed by the University of Cambridge and conducted in more than 130 countries to measure four skills. The evaluation is divided into 5 stages from Pre-intermediate (basic) to Professional (highest level), and if you acquire Upper intermediate (intermediate level), you will be able to work in English-speaking countries or anywhere in the EU. It is recognized that there is. It is a test that can measure the operational ability to actually use English rather than the question of knowledge of English.

It is better to measure 4 English skills with the index called CEFR.

We have introduced various certification exams so far, but CEFR is an effective index for comparing each qualification exam. What is CEFR? (Cefal) is an abbreviation of "Common Eurpean Framework of Reference for Languages", which is an international evaluation index that measures the level of four English skills, and is useful for objectively measuring English proficiency.

There are 6 levels of CEFR, A1, A2, B1, B2, C1 and C2, and the closer you are to C2, the higher the level. Scores such as TOEIC and TOEFL and Eiken grades can also be converted to CEFR, so you can compare the level of different English tests with international indicators.

Tips for improving your English listening

The key to improving your listening skills is to acquire knowledge of grammar and words, and to become accustomed to the pronunciation peculiar to English. If you read something that you don't understand, you won't understand it, so first learn the basics of grammar and expand your vocabulary.

The vowels and consonants, rhythms, sound connections and sound strengths that are unique to English are unfamiliar to Japanese, so you need to be aware of them. As a training method for that, sharding that listens to the English sound source and pronounces it while imitating it with a slight delay, and dictation that writes while listening to the sound source are effective. You can use your own reference book or other sound source, so please try it.

Tips for improving your English reading

The key to improving your reading ability is to develop a habit of understanding English as it is. For example, if "teacher" appears in an English sentence, read it as "teacher" instead of translating it into Japanese in your head. It's a good idea to use an English-English dictionary to understand the meaning of words in English instead of Japanese translation.

Another trick is to add a habit of reading in the English word order. It may be difficult for people who have a habit of translating and reading while returning from behind, but there are ways to practice. It is to read a lot of picture books for children and simple English sentences at the level of the first grade of junior high school. The content is simple, so you can read it in word order. Extensive reading will be a habitual training.

Tips for improving English speaking

The key to improving your speaking ability is not to translate what you want to say into Japanese and then translate it into English, but to assemble an English sentence suddenly. At that time, be aware of using simple words and grammar.

The training method is to imagine a conversation and write what you want to say in English in your head. You don't have to suddenly make a perfect English sentence without any mistakes. Be aware of constructing English sentences without using Japanese. It's a good idea to write it out before you get used to it. Later, I will look up the ambiguous parts of words, grammar, and pronunciation in a dictionary and check them. It may take some time at first glance, but you can improve your speaking ability by repeating this process.

Tips for improving English writing

The key to improving your writing skills is to know the basic writing process. First, write an assertion about the theme, give three reasons, grounds, and cases to support it, and finally conclude by summarizing the story so far. The logical English sentences seen in long reading comprehension problems are often developed in the order of assertion, grounds, and conclusions, so it is good to refer to them. Once you know how to write a sentence, practice writing on various themes and get used to it.
